In the multiverse, nestled around the Central Planar Region lies the ancient and foundational Inner Planar Region. This region, older than all other parts of the multiverse, is the primeval crucible from which everything was molded. Its existence predates the rest of the cosmology, and it is here that the basic elements and energies for the rest of the planes continue to be provided, maintaining the very fabric of creation.

The Inner Planar Region is not just a collection of elemental forces but a vast and intricate tapestry of existence, woven from the very fabric of primal energies. Beyond the six major planes, each representing the purest form of an elemental or energy type, there are a larger quantity of planes that represent the primal combination of two elements, or an element and an energy type. But even beyond those, there lies an almost infinite expanse of demiplanes, that are the result of the complex interplay and fusion of the primary elemental and energy forces, creating a rich and ever-changing landscape of possibilities.

Imagine the Inner Planar Region as an artist's palette, where the primary colors are the major planes, vibrant and distinct. But just as an artist mixes colors to create new hues and shades, the forces within this region blend and merge to form demiplanes, each unique in its composition and character. These demiplanes are not mere offshoots but full-fledged realms in their own right, each harboring its own mysteries, inhabitants, and laws of nature.

The Inner Planar Region, with its major planes and countless demiplanes, represents the raw potential of creation, where the boundaries of reality are not just pushed but completely reimagined. It's a place where the very essence of existence is woven, unwoven, and rewoven, offering endless possibilities for exploration, adventure, and discovery.

The Energy Planes

The Energy Planes embody the fundamental forces of creation and destruction. The Positive Energy Plane is a radiant, life-giving realm, essential to the vitality of living beings but overwhelming in its unchecked abundance. In stark contrast, the Negative Energy Plane emanates entropic darkness, a void where life withers, representing the ultimate end of all existence. These planes are not merely sources of raw energy but are complex environments, teeming with unique phenomena and entities, pivotal in the balance and cycle of cosmic life and death.

There are two Energy Planes:

  • The Positive Energy Plane: This realm is a brilliant tapestry of light and vitality, where every breath is imbued with the potential for growth and rejuvenation. The Positive Energy Plane is the wellspring of life, a boundless source of healing and renewal. Its luminescent landscapes are awe-inspiring, yet dangerously overwhelming, for the unbridled life force that pervades this plane can invigorate as swiftly as it can obliterate, granting life in abundance or causing life to burgeon into unchecked, rampant growth.
  • The Negative Energy Plane: A realm of entropy and dissolution, where shadows reign over a void of desolation and decay. This plane is the antithesis of life, a domain where the very essence of existence is unraveled and consumed. It is a place of eerie tranquility and inexorable decline, where the absence of life and light is not merely a void but a tangible force. The Negative Energy Plane holds the chilling allure of the ultimate end, wielding the power to erode, exhaust, and extinguish.
